How to Make Peach Cobbler Pound Cake
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:
Step 1: Preheat Your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a loaf pan so your beautiful creation doesn’t stick.
Step 2: Prepare Peaches
Wash and slice about two cups of fresh peaches. If you’re feeling adventurous, mix in some cinnamon or nutmeg to sprinkle over them for added flavor.
Step 3: Cream Butter and Sugar
In a large bowl, cream together softened unsalted butter and granulated sugar until light and fluffy. This step is crucial—it creates air pockets that give life to your cake!
Step 4: Add Eggs and Vanilla
Beat in eggs one at a time—this takes patience! Then stir in vanilla extract until fully combined. You’ll want this mixture smooth as silk.
Step 5: Combine Dry Ingredients
In another bowl, whisk together all-purpose flour and baking powder. Gradually add this dry blend to your wet mixture alternating with milk until everything is just combined—don’t overmix!
Step 6: Fold in Peaches
Gently fold in those luscious peach slices until they are evenly distributed throughout the batter. Pour this golden goodness into your prepared loaf pan.
Bake for about an hour or until you can insert a toothpick into the center and it comes out clean.
Let cool slightly before slicing into this heavenly Peach Cobbler Pound Cake. Serve warm with whipped cream or even better—a scoop of vanilla ice cream! Trust me; it’s pure bliss on a plate!

How do I store Peach Cobbler Pound Cake?
To store your Peach Cobbler Pound Cake,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il to keep it fresh. Place it in an airtight container and store it at room temperature for up to three days. For longer storage, you can refrigerate it for about a week or freeze slices for up to three months. Make sure to thaw it at room temperature before serving.
Can I use frozen peaches in this recipe?
Yes, you can use frozen peaches to make Peach Cobbler Pound Cake! Just ensure that you thaw and drain any excess moisture from the peaches before adding them to the batter. This will help maintain the right consistency of the cake without making it too soggy. Frozen peaches are a great alternative when fresh ones are out of season.

Ingredients
- 2 cups fresh peaches, sliced
- 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 ½ tsp baking powder
- ½ cup unsalted butter, softened
- 3 large eggs
- 2 tsp vanilla extract
- ½ cup milk
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a loaf pan.
- In a bowl, cream together the softened butter and sugar until fluffy.
- Beat in eggs one at a time, followed by vanilla extract.
- In another bowl, combine flour and baking powder; gradually mix this into the wet ingredients alternating with milk.
- Gently fold in peach slices until evenly distributed.
-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an and bake for about 60 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ean.
